Abstract

A base panel suitable to be processed into a covering panel, consisting of the following layers: (i) a substrate having a top surface, (ii) a resilient layer having a top surface and a bottom surface, whereby the bottom surface is connected to the top surface of said substrate, and (iii) optionally, a contact layer between the bottom surface of said resilient layer and the top surface of said substrate. A covering panel further comprising a digitally printed decor on the top surface of the resilient layer of the base panel, and a process of producing covering panels from said base panels.
